  • Applications

    2-(ar-Ethylphenyl)butyraldehyde (CAS 68228-11-5) is primarily used as a synthetic intermediate in fragrance chemistry, where it serves as a building block for aroma compounds and for generating specialized fragrance ingredients. It is commonly evaluated as a precursor in cosmetics and personal care formulations to furnish fragrance components. In household and cleaning products, it can be used to develop desired scent profiles as part of fragrance systems. In coatings and inks, it is employed as an aromatic aldehyde intermediate to introduce fragrance notes or as a reactive building block. In polymers and plastics, it may participate as a functionalized aldehyde for crosslinking or as a precursor to aromatic polymers. The use of this compound is typically governed by local regulations and formulation limits.
